Abstract
An off-road vehicle has four wheels and side-by-side driver and passenger seats. At least two of the wheels are driven by an electric motor powered by batteries disposed in the vehicle.

18. An off-road vehicle comprising:
-
a frame; a cockpit area defined in the frame; a roll cage connected to the frame, the roll cage covering at least in part the cockpit area; a driver seat and a passenger seat disposed side-by-side in the cockpit area; an electric motor supported by the frame, the electric motor being disposed laterally between the driver and passenger seats; at least one first battery electrically connected to the electric motor, the at least one first battery being supported by the frame and being disposed on a right side of the electric motor; at least one second battery electrically connected to the electric motor, the at least one second battery being supported by the frame and being disposed on a left side of the electric motor; two front wheels and two rear wheels supported by the frame, at least two of the wheels being operatively connected to the electric motor for propelling the vehicle; and a steering device being operatively connected to at least two of the wheels for steering the vehicle. - View Dependent Claims (19, 20, 21, 22, 23, 24, 35, 37, 38, 39)

25. An off-road vehicle comprising:
-
a frame; a cockpit area defined in the frame; a roll cage connected to the frame, the roll cage covering at least in part the cockpit area; a driver seat and a passenger seat disposed side-by-side in the cockpit area; an electric motor supported by the frame, the electric motor being disposed laterally between the driver and passenger seats; at least one first battery electrically connected to the electric motor, the at least one first battery being supported by the frame and being disposed forwardly of the electric motor; at least one second battery electrically connected to the electric motor, the at least one second battery being supported by the frame and being disposed rearwardly of the electric motor; two front wheels and two rear wheels supported by the frame, at least two of the wheels being operatively connected to the electric motor for propelling the vehicle; and a steering device being operatively connected to at least two of the wheels for steering the vehicle. - View Dependent Claims (26, 27, 28)

33. An off-road vehicle comprising:
-
a frame; a cockpit area defined in the frame; a roll cage connected to the frame, the roll cage covering at least in part the cockpit area; a driver seat and a passenger seat disposed side-by-side in the cockpit area; an electric motor supported by the frame, the electric motor being disposed laterally between the driver and passenger seats; at least one battery electrically connected to the electric motor, the at least one battery being supported by the frame and being disposed rearwardly of the electric motor; two front wheels and two rear wheels supported by the frame; a rear gear assembly operatively connecting the two rear wheels to the electric motor, the rear gear assembly having a rear gear assembly housing, at least one of the at least one battery being disposed vertically above the rear gear assembly housing and having a portion disposed longitudinally between front and rear ends of the rear gear assembly housing; and a steering device being operatively connected to at least two of the wheels for steering the vehicle. - View Dependent Claims (34)
